Transaction 89b5f8fc148cb0b98bf0f34f1b6672cd7d909326f6dd8dc7eb7979591b0a301c
1 Input
1 Output
-
89b5f8fc148cb0b98bf0f34f1b6672cd7d909326f6dd8dc7eb7979591b0a301c:0
- value
- 2999620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376c6dad85067fa26fb3159b3c58ff510fea5 OP_EQUAL
- address
- 3BMEXrnq8kUqn8Nx9ptHVu1sZuR6qByfXs